Mouse Events:
1.click,dbclick
2.focusin,focusout
3.mousedown,mouseout,mouseup,mousemove,mouseover,mouseenter,mouseleave
$(".see-photos").on("click", function(event) { event.preventDefault();//阻止同一node,的相同的其他事件 执行。 event.stopPropagation();//阻止点击链接后,页面跳到顶端。即不要重现加载 $(this).closest(".tour").find(".photos").slideToggle(); });
var price = +$(this).val();//前面的加号+,是表示把当前的value 转换成 number类型
Keyboard Events:
1.keypress
2.keydown
3.keyup
Form Events:
1.blur
2.select
3.change
4.foucs
5.submit
相关推荐
`Ajax`(Asynchronous JavaScript and XML)技术使得页面无需刷新即可与服务器进行交互,而`jQuery`库则简化了JavaScript的使用,大大提高了开发效率。`UploadBean`是一个处理文件上传的Java后端组件,它与`Ajax`和`...
jQuery 1.11采用模块化设计,每个功能模块如`event.js`、`ajax.js`等,都负责特定的功能,这使得代码结构清晰,易于理解。同时,模块间的依赖关系通过函数调用和变量共享来实现。 3. **选择器引擎Sizzle** 选择器...
#9897:try-catch isPlainObject detection #10076:$.inArray crashes IE6 and Chrome if second argument is `null` or `undefined` CSS #6652:Remove filter:alpha(opacity=100) after animation #9572:...
try { // 保存文件到服务器,验证等操作 return "文件上传成功"; } catch (IOException e) { return "文件上传失败:" + e.getMessage(); } } else { return "请选择文件"; } } } ``` 在上述示例中,`...
2. **性能优化**:jQuery通过缓存DOM查询结果,减少DOM操作,以及利用`try...catch`避免异常处理的开销等方式,提升了运行效率。 3. **兼容性处理**:jQuery对各种浏览器的差异进行了大量的兼容性处理,使得开发者...
3. **事件处理(Event Handling)** - 使用`on()`方法绑定事件,如`$("#element").on("click", function() {})`监听点击事件。`off()`用于解除事件绑定,`trigger()`可以手动触发事件。 4. **动画效果(Effects)*...
3. **事件处理(Event Handling)**:jQuery 的事件处理非常直观,如 `click()`、`mouseover()` 等,可以方便地绑定和解绑事件。同时,`on()` 方法可以用于处理动态添加的元素的事件。 4. **动画效果(Animation)*...
- **事件绑定**:`on(event, function)`,当事件发生时执行函数。 - **隐藏和显示元素**:`hide()` 和 `show()`,控制元素的可见性。 - **获取或设置CSS属性**:`css(property, value)`,用于修改元素的样式。 - **...
10. 错误处理和调试:通过`try...catch`语句捕获异常,以及使用开发者工具进行代码调试。 这个项目不仅展示了HTML5、jQuery和JavaScript在游戏开发中的应用,还涉及到前端开发的基本流程,包括设计、编码、测试和...
'onQueueComplete': function(event, queueID, files) { alert('所有文件已成功上传!'); }, 'onUploadProgress': function(file, bytesUploaded, bytesTotal, totalBytesUploaded, totalBytesTotal) { var ...
在实际开发中,为了保证代码的可维护性和扩展性,我们还需要遵循良好的编程实践,如模块化(使用`$.fn.extend()`创建插件)、错误处理(使用`try...catch`结构)以及代码注释。 总结一下,实现jQuery手机通讯录选中...
AJAX(Asynchronous JavaScript and XML)虽然最初与XML紧密相关,但现在更多地是用于传输JSON或其他文本格式的数据。在jQuery中,我们通过$.ajax()方法来发起一个AJAX请求。 ```javascript $.ajax({ url: 'your_...
a(b).parents().andSelf().filter(function(){return a.curCSS(this,"visibility")==="hidden"||a.expr.filters.hidden(this)}).length}function c(b,c){var e=b.nodeName.toLowerCase();if("area"===e){var f=b....
Ajax(Asynchronous JavaScript and XML)是一种在不刷新整个页面的情况下与服务器进行通信的技术,从而提高用户体验。jQuery库简化了这个过程,提供了易于使用的API来处理Ajax请求。 首先,我们需要确保项目中已经...
异常处理TryExcept 网络编程Socket介绍 Socket通信案例消息发送与接收 第8周 上节回顾 Socket实现简单的ssh客户端 Socket实现简单的ssh服务端 积极思考正能量 Socket实现简单的ssh2 Socket粘包 Socket粘包深入编码...
try { for (var n in objList) { nn = objList[n]; t = nn.getOption("target")[0]; if (_isClick && (t == dom || t.contains(dom))) return; if (!_isClick || !nn.box[0].contains(dom)) nn.hide(); } } ...
在JavaScript和jQuery的世界里,事件绑定是网页交互的基础,但同时也可能引发内存泄漏问题,特别是在老版本的浏览器中。当一个元素从DOM树中被移除时,如果它还绑定了事件,这些事件处理程序将继续占用内存,导致...
测试代码: 代码如下: (function(){ var p=new PEvent(document); p.click(function() { //alert(“单击”); //alert(p.style)... p.contextmenu(function(event) { try{ var x=event.